A piercing might not close due to the formation of scar tissue, the length of time you’ve had the piercing, or continuous irritation and movement. Keeping the area clean and free from irritation is crucial. If it remains a concern, consult a professional piercer or dermatologist for advice on potential treatments.
FAQs & Answers
- What can I do if my piercing isn’t healing? Keep the area clean, avoid irritants, and consider consulting a professional if healing problems persist.
- Can I use ointments for a healing piercing? Only use recommended products by a piercer, as certain ointments can irritate the skin further.
- How long does it take for a piercing to close? The time varies by piercing type, but generally, it can take weeks to months depending on individual healing.
- What irritates a piercing? Common irritants include harsh soaps, jewelry movement, and contact with bacteria, so careful cleaning and management are essential.
